> On Wednesday 28. April 2010 13.25.39 Matthieu Gallien wrote:
> > You need it in order to export and import the contextual menu of status
> > notifier item. This allows the systemtray applet to locally render the
> > menu instead of asking the application to display the menu at a given
> > position. This way, no matter what toolkit the application is using the
> > menu is rendered by the workspace in a consistent manner.

you sound neither whiny nor bitchy, just not aware of all the benefits. fair 
enough:

* it lets us do things like integrate the menus with the taskbar entries 
(won't happen for 4.5, but watch for it in 4.6) ... just think of how this 
opens the door for nice dock plugins too!

* it lets us perform things like "Mouse scrubbing" where you move your mouse 
over the set of icons like you do a menubar in an app

* it lets us not use a menu when it's more appropriate to use something else 
(e.g. on mobile)

* it lets us pop up menus even when the app on the other side is busy with a 
modal dialog (you have no idea how much this annoys me on a weekly basis with 
ktorrent :)

it turns out that a truly modern desktop shell is slightly more complicated 
with more use case details than many people appreciate :)
